In FY24 UBPS partners worked with 28 campus units. Among other important collaborations, funding for Athletics, Dining, People & Culture and the Retirement Center helped the university to advance key initiatives related to student-athlete scholarships, sustainable dining and workforce development and retention.
Cal Athletics
During a transformative time for college sports, UBPS partners invested $1,432,260 in Cal Athletics, including $173,260 from BMO for student-athlete scholarships.
Such funding supported the Golden Bears 91% Graduation Success Rate as they began to navigate the transition to a new conference and a new era of college athletics.
Berkeley Dining
As we continue to fight climate change, greener food and beverage systems are essential to reducing our environmental impact. PepsiCo’s partnership with Berkeley Dining helped to fund the initial phase of a university “farm to fork” initiative, as well as a trial of a more sustainable approach to beverage service—PepsiCo’s SodaStream Professional system. The farm initiative will help Dining source ingredients from a farm immediately adjacent to campus.
People & Culture + Retirement Center
The university remains a desirable workplace thanks to its employee-centric culture, highlighted at our semi-annual staff appreciation events. UBPS partners, including Farmers Insurance, contributed $65,000 to Berkeley People & Culture and the university’s Retirement Center to further employee and retiree welfare through professional development events, special discounts, and lifelong learning opportunities.
